Before any manual labor starts, a certified electrician needs to perform a comprehensive evaluation of your residential or commercial property's existing electrical facilities to figure out whether it can safely support an EV charger installation. Older homes across Sydney's inner suburban areas, in particular, frequently have aging switchboards that were never ever designed to accommodate the extra load that comes with electrical lorry charging. In these cases, a switchboard upgrade becomes a required prerequisite, contributing to the total project website scope but considerably enhancing the safety and dependability of the entire electrical system in the process. The evaluation stage also includes recognizing the most ideal place for the charging unit, considering elements such as cable routing distance, weatherproofing requirements, and ease of gain access to for daily usage. The type of charger picked for your EV charger installation will have a direct bearing on how quickly your automobile charges and just how much the overall job expenses. For the majority of Sydney households, a Level 2 air conditioning charger operating on a 32-amp devoted circuit represents the most practical and economical option, capable of providing a full charge overnight for the vast majority of electrical vehicle models presently on the market. Level 1 charging by means of a standard 10-amp power point is technically possible however widely regarded as insufficient for everyday driving needs provided how gradually it renews the battery. DC quick battery chargers, while remarkably quick, are prohibitively expensive for home installation and are better suited to commercial settings such as shopping centres, service stations, and fleet depots. Discussing your specific automobile model, day-to-day kilometre range, and future-proofing objectives with your installer guarantees the EV charger installation is sized and set up appropriately for your circumstances rather than just defaulting to the cheapest offered alternative.
Every Sydney house owner should comprehend the regulative landscape that governs EV charger installations in New South Wales before any work starts. All electrical work needs to abide by the AS/NZS 3000 wiring code, and depending upon the task's size and intricacy, an alert or approval from the proper authority might be required. Just a licensed electrician is authorized by law to perform this work, and a certificate of compliance should be released upon conclusion to validate that the installation pleases all pertinent requirements. House owners who attempt to cut expenses by working with unlicensed labor danger revoking their home insurance coverage, sustaining significant fines, and creating real security dangers for their household and home. Cautious budgeting is an essential step when starting any EV‑charging station project, and house owners in Sydney should anticipate a variety of costs based on the particular needs of their circumstance. An easy fit‑out in a contemporary home equipped with a suitable switchboard and a garage placed nearby will fall towards the lower end of the cost variety, whereas homes that need comprehensive electrical upgrades, lengthy cable television runs, or custom-made weather‑proof real estates will inevitably cost more. Numerous Sydney residents are now combining EV‑charger installations with rooftop solar arrays to increase their roi, due to the fact that this setup lets cars and trucks charge from self‑produced sustainable power instead of relying exclusively on the grid.
